> Now suddenly the spec handler is running again and this time the driver supplied IRQ-routine (vInterruptService)
> is called, but with the 2 ms of delay.
>
> Unfortunately I'm not able to interpret the flags correctly. Especially since the ones described in the header
> do not match the number of fields in the output...
So this delay is caused by the softirq rework. I didn't think about this
but now that you show the trace it is obvious.
If you use
request_threaded_irq(, NULL, vInterruptService, …);
instead of
request_irq(, vInterruptService, …);
then the IRQ will not be force threaded (but threaded on request) and
there will be no local_bh_disable() before the thread is invoked. So no
waiting until the AHCI thread is done.
If vInterruptService() does nothing else than just wake up userland then
you could use swait_event_…() / swake_up_one() instead of the
wait_event_… / wake_up() combo. That would be allowed from the primary
handler and you could avoid the switch to the threaded-handler.
